The global active calcium silicate market size was valued at USD 362.46 Million in 2024. Looking forward, IMARC Group estimates the market to reach USD 546.76 Million by 2033, exhibiting a CAGR of 4.44% from 2025-2033. Europe currently dominates the market with 37.7% of the share in 2024. The rising demand in fire-resistant construction materials due to safety regulations, heightened adoption in sustainable green buildings meeting LEED standards, and rapidly expanding industrial applications for thermal insulation and energy efficiency in high-temperature industries like oil, gas, and manufacturing are some of the factors impacting the market positively.
Active calcium silicate is a chemical with a high-water absorption rate and a low bulk density. It is widely used to replace highly toxic asbestos compounds in various industrial applications that require high strength and durability. It is also utilized for preventing corrosion caused by electrolytic cells and entrapped moisture in insulated enclosures. Apart from this, it finds extensive usage in improving the mechanical properties of bioactive glasses and making them suitable for load-bearing purposes.
Active calcium silicate-based materials are widely utilized in numerous endodontic and oral surgical procedures as they have excellent apical sealing and can acquire high pH after mixing. In line with this, as these materials decrease therapy duration and reduce the risk of tooth fractures and incomplete calcification, the increasing prevalence of oral diseases represents one of the key factors impelling the market growth. Moreover, the growing geriatric population, which is more vulnerable to develop dental decay, gum diseases, oral cancer, mouth infections, and tooth loss, is driving the demand for nanostructured active calcium silicates for effective root canal obturation therapy. Furthermore, increasing road accidents and traumatic experiences are expanding the applications of nanostructured active calcium silicate as grafts in bone regeneration around the world. Apart from this, the burgeoning construction industry is contributing to the utilization of active calcium silicate foams for the internal insulation of walls. Additionally, several manufacturers are developing active calcium silicates using nanotechnology to enhance their physical properties, such as flowability, consistency, and setting time. Such innovations are anticipated to increase product use in different end use industries across the globe and propel the market growth.
